TALLAHASSEE COMMUNITY

COLLEGE

CAMPUS MASTER PLAN

This three-time award-winning Campus Master Plan consisted of a comprehensive, 25-year master plan of the Tallahassee Community College campus. The plan employs a harmonious blend of form and function by adhering to sustainable, urban and interactive architectural design principles including integrating environmental systems with the campus’s existing spatial system, optimizing land resources while maintaining the campus scale of development, maximizing pedestrian access for an improved walking campus, creating a lively environment for social and academic interaction, extending and enhancing the garden landscape that characterizes the unique environmental qualities of the existing campus and creating a sustainable master plan that follows USGBC LEED design guidelines. Situated on a flat former airport site, the college faces significant site issues, including periodic flooding. This master plan seeks a new approach that conceives the future campus as an integral, sustainable part of the eco-management system while being a vibrant place for learning, interaction, recreation, nature and delight. At the heart of the Campus Master Plan is the idea of a campus organized around a simple framework of pedestrian open-space axes, integrated with an innovative storm water system that serves as an eco-amenity
